Unlock Your Vibe Coding Career: Navigating the Remote Job Market and Landing Your Dream Role
Level up your career with AI! Learn about the vibe coding job market, top skills, interview tips, and where to find your dream remote role.
RVCJ Editorial
Editorial Team
The Remote Vibe Coding Jobs editorial team covers AI-assisted development, remote work trends, and career guides for modern developers.
Navigating the Vibe Coding Career Path in a Remote World
So, you're ready to dive into the world of vibe coding? Awesome! You're not alone. The rise of AI-assisted development is transforming the software landscape, and the demand for developers who can effectively leverage these tools is skyrocketing. But what exactly is “vibe coding,” and how do you break into this exciting field?
In essence, vibe coding is about harnessing the power of AI coding assistants like GitHub Copilot, Cursor, Claude, and Replit Agent to amplify your coding abilities. It's about understanding the nuances of natural language prompting, iterating quickly, and focusing on the bigger picture while the AI handles the boilerplate. It's a collaborative dance between human ingenuity and machine intelligence.
This post will guide you through navigating the vibe coding career path, exploring the vibe coding job market, and landing your dream remote role.
Understanding the Evolving Vibe Coding Job Market
The vibe coding job market is still relatively new, but it's growing rapidly. Companies are recognizing the potential of AI-assisted development to boost productivity and innovation. This translates into a growing number of remote job opportunities for developers skilled in using these technologies.
What kind of roles are we talking about? You might see positions like:
- AI-Assisted Software Engineer: The core of vibe coding, focusing on building applications with AI tools.
- Prompt Engineer: Crafting effective prompts to guide AI models for code generation, testing, and documentation.
- AI-Augmented Full-Stack Developer: Leveraging AI to accelerate development across the entire stack.
- Solutions Architect (AI-Focused): Designing and implementing AI-powered solutions for businesses.
The key takeaway? The demand for developers who can effectively collaborate with AI is only going to increase.
Essential Skills for a Vibe Coding Career
While AI tools can handle a lot of the heavy lifting, you still need a strong foundation in software development principles. Here are some essential skills to cultivate:
- Solid Programming Fundamentals: Understanding data structures, algorithms, and object-oriented programming is crucial.
- Experience with Popular Programming Languages: Python, JavaScript, TypeScript, and Go are all highly relevant.
- Familiarity with AI Coding Assistants: Gaining hands-on experience with tools like GitHub Copilot, Cursor, Claude, and Replit Agent is essential. Experiment with different tools to find what works best for your workflow.
- Prompt Engineering Skills: Learning how to craft clear, concise, and effective prompts is key to getting the most out of AI assistants. Think of it as learning to communicate effectively with the AI.
- Version Control (Git): Managing your code with Git is more important than ever when working with AI-generated code.
- Cloud Computing (AWS, Azure, GCP): Familiarity with cloud platforms is increasingly important for deploying and scaling AI-powered applications.
- Testing and Debugging: You still need to be able to test and debug AI-generated code to ensure its correctness and reliability.
- Strong Communication Skills: Being able to articulate your ideas, explain technical concepts clearly, and collaborate effectively with your team is crucial, especially in a remote environment.
- Critical Thinking and Problem-Solving: Don't blindly trust the AI! You need to be able to critically evaluate the generated code and identify potential issues.
Furthermore, understand that the best "vibe coders" are not just programmers; they are *designers* who can envision a user interface, a system architecture, or a new product and then use AI to rapidly prototype and iterate. Tools like v0 and Bolt are also expanding the landscape.
Ace Your Vibe Coding Interview: What to Expect
Landing a vibe coding job requires more than just technical skills; it requires demonstrating your ability to work effectively with AI. Here's what you can expect in a vibe coding interview:
- Technical Questions: Be prepared to answer questions about your programming experience, data structures, algorithms, and software design principles.
- AI-Specific Questions: Expect questions about your experience with AI coding assistants, your understanding of prompt engineering, and your ability to debug AI-generated code.
- Coding Challenges: You may be asked to solve coding problems using an AI assistant. This is your chance to demonstrate your ability to collaborate with AI in real-time.
- Behavioral Questions: Be prepared to answer questions about your problem-solving skills, your ability to learn new technologies, and your communication skills.
- Scenario-Based Questions: You might be presented with a real-world scenario and asked how you would use AI to solve it. This is your opportunity to showcase your creativity and problem-solving abilities.
Some example vibe coding interview questions you might encounter:
- "Describe your experience using AI coding assistants like GitHub Copilot or Cursor. What are the benefits and drawbacks you've encountered?"
- "Walk me through a time when you used an AI coding assistant to solve a complex problem. What were the key steps you took?"
- "How do you approach debugging AI-generated code? What strategies do you use to ensure its correctness?"
- "Explain your understanding of prompt engineering. What are some best practices for crafting effective prompts?"
- "How do you stay up-to-date with the latest advancements in AI-assisted development?"
Finding Remote Vibe Coding Jobs: Where to Look
Finding the right remote vibe coding job requires knowing where to look. Here are some top resources:
- RemoteVibeCodingJobs.com: (Shameless plug!) We specialize in curating remote jobs specifically for AI-assisted developers. browse vibe coding jobs today!
- General Job Boards: Sites like Indeed, LinkedIn, and Glassdoor often list remote software engineering positions that involve AI.
- AI-Specific Job Boards: Some job boards focus specifically on AI-related roles.
- Company Websites: Check the careers pages of companies that are known for using AI in their development processes. explore companies hiring now.
- Networking: Connect with other developers in the AI space and let them know you're looking for a job.
Remember to tailor your resume and cover letter to each specific job you apply for, highlighting your experience with AI coding assistants and your relevant skills.
Pro Tips for Landing Your Dream Remote Vibe Coding Role
- Build a Portfolio: Showcase your projects that demonstrate your ability to use AI coding assistants effectively.
- Contribute to Open Source: Contribute to open-source projects that utilize AI coding assistants. This is a great way to demonstrate your skills and gain experience.
- Stay Up-to-Date: The field of AI is constantly evolving, so it's important to stay up-to-date with the latest advancements. Read blogs, attend conferences, and take online courses.
- Network: Connect with other developers in the AI space and build relationships.
- Practice Your Prompt Engineering Skills: Experiment with different prompts and learn how to craft effective prompts for different tasks.
- Be Patient: Finding the right job takes time and effort. Don't get discouraged if you don't find your dream role right away. Keep learning, keep networking, and keep applying.
The vibe coding job market is ripe with opportunity. By honing your skills, understanding the landscape, and leveraging the resources available to you, you can unlock your dream remote role and embark on an exciting and rewarding career.
FAQ: Vibe Coding Career Path, Job Market, and Interviews
Q: What is the typical career path for someone interested in vibe coding?A: The vibe coding career path often starts with a strong foundation in software engineering. From there, developers can specialize in AI-assisted development by gaining experience with tools like GitHub Copilot and learning prompt engineering techniques.
Q: What are the salary expectations in the vibe coding job market?A: Salaries in the vibe coding job market are generally competitive, especially for experienced developers with strong AI skills. The exact salary will depend on your experience level, location, and the specific role.
Q: What are some common vibe coding interview questions I should prepare for?A: Be prepared to answer questions about your experience with AI coding assistants, your understanding of prompt engineering, and your ability to debug AI-generated code. Also, practice solving coding problems using AI tools.
Q: Where can I find the best vibe coding job boards?A: RemoteVibeCodingJobs.com is a great place to start your search for remote vibe coding jobs. You can also find relevant positions on general job boards and company websites.
Browse Related Remote Jobs
Find remote developer jobs that match the topics in this article.
Related Articles
Decoding the Vibe: Your Guide to Remote Coding Jobs, Career Paths, and the Job Market
Ready to ride the wave of AI-assisted development? Learn about the vibe coding job market, career paths, interview tips, & find your dream role!
Unlock Your Potential: Navigating the Vibe Coding Career Path (Success Stories & Interview Tips)
Want a vibe coding career? Learn the skills, tools, and interview secrets to land your dream remote AI-assisted development job. Success stories inside!
Unlock Your Potential: A Deep Dive into the Vibe Coding Career Path (Remote Opportunities Included)
Explore the vibe coding career path! Learn about the job market, interview tips, work-life balance, and find remote opportunities now!
Daily digest
The best vibe coding jobs, in your inbox
Curated remote dev roles at async-first, no-BS companies. No spam, unsubscribe anytime.